首页 >> 综合 >

如何excel拆分单元格

2026-01-20 23:03:54 来源:网易 用户:支明雨 

如何excel拆分单元格】在日常使用Excel的过程中,我们经常会遇到需要将一个单元格中的内容拆分成多个单元格的情况。例如,一个单元格中包含了姓名、电话号码、地址等信息,想要分别提取出来,方便后续处理或分析。本文将详细介绍几种常见的Excel拆分单元格的方法,并提供操作步骤和示例。

一、使用“分列”功能拆分单元格

这是最常用的一种方法,适用于数据中包含固定分隔符(如逗号、空格、顿号等)的情况。

操作步骤:

1. 选中需要拆分的单元格区域;

2. 点击菜单栏中的【数据】选项卡;

3. 在【数据工具】组中点击【分列】;

4. 选择【分隔符号】,点击【下一步】;

5. 勾选需要使用的分隔符(如逗号、空格等),点击【下一步】;

6. 设置目标区域(可选),点击【完成】。

示例表格:

原始数据 拆分后结果
张三,13800000000 张三 13800000000
李四,13900000000 李四 13900000000

二、使用公式拆分单元格

如果数据中没有固定分隔符,或者需要更灵活的拆分方式,可以使用Excel的文本函数进行拆分。

常用函数:

- `LEFT(text, num_chars)`:从左侧开始提取指定数量的字符;

- `RIGHT(text, num_chars)`:从右侧开始提取指定数量的字符;

- `MID(text, start_num, num_chars)`:从指定位置开始提取指定数量的字符;

- `FIND(find_text, within_text)`:查找某个字符的位置。

示例公式:

假设A1单元格内容为“北京-朝阳区-建国门”,想拆分为“北京”、“朝阳区”、“建国门”。

- B1 = LEFT(A1, FIND("-", A1) - 1)

- C1 = MID(A1, FIND("-", A1) + 1, FIND("-", A1, FIND("-", A1) + 1) - FIND("-", A1) - 1)

- D1 = RIGHT(A1, LEN(A1) - FIND("-", A1, FIND("-", A1) + 1))

示例表格:

原始数据 拆分后结果1 拆分后结果2 拆分后结果3
北京-朝阳区-建国门 北京 朝阳区 建国门

三、使用Power Query拆分单元格

对于大量数据的拆分,推荐使用Power Query,它能高效处理复杂的数据结构。

操作步骤:

1. 选中数据区域,点击【插入】→【表格】;

2. 点击【数据】→【获取数据】→【从表格/区域】;

3. 在Power Query编辑器中,选中要拆分的列;

4. 点击【拆分列】→【按分隔符】;

5. 选择分隔符并设置拆分方式,点击【确定】;

6. 点击【关闭并上载】,数据将返回到Excel中。

四、总结

方法 适用场景 优点 缺点
分列功能 数据有固定分隔符 操作简单、快速 不支持复杂拆分
公式拆分 数据无固定分隔符或需自定义 灵活、可定制 需要熟悉函数
Power Query 大量数据或复杂结构 功能强大、效率高 学习成本稍高

通过以上方法,你可以根据实际需求选择最适合的方式来拆分Excel中的单元格,提高工作效率和数据准确性。

  免责声明:本文由用户上传,与本网站立场无关。财经信息仅供读者参考,并不构成投资建议。投资者据此操作,风险自担。 如有侵权请联系删除!

 
分享:
最新文章